Output ec34d108a923f1d0e4d953c1704c6493230242113ee719678039f457fd77d17a:6

value
629683
script pubkey
OP_0 OP_PUSHBYTES_20 157e5a310111dcd44f44f5731506cb0168bf2a13
address
bc1qz4l95vgpz8wdgn6y74e32pktq95t72sn9agqxy
transaction
ec34d108a923f1d0e4d953c1704c6493230242113ee719678039f457fd77d17a
spent
true